#dca198 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dca198 is composed of 86.3% red, 63.1%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.8% magenta, 30.9%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 7.9 degrees, a saturation of 49.3% and a lightness of 72.9%. #dca198 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b94331.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#dca198 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dca198 has RGB values of R:220, G:161,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0.31,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14459288.

Shades and Tints of #dca198
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0605 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#dca198
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bcb8b8 is the less saturated color, while #fc8a78 is the most saturated one.
